    Hi Susan, love your channel, your enthusiasm, and your content. I have a question for you. I don't know if your a realtor in florida or not, either way you may have this knowledge. Can you tell me if you can buy property 2-10 acres and put a mobile home on there yourself? The price for the land maybe a lot cheaper, but I'd have to find a mobile home and hook up to electric$?/water$?/sewer$? or perhaps there might be an alternative to these. I'm trying to eliminate "monthly bills" and live simply. Or maybe its just as inexpensive buying a mobile home with land that you've suggested. Any suggestions would be awesome! TIA

      Hello, you can certainly buy a parcel of land to place a MH on it and connect it to utilities. It will depend on the county and their rules for Manufactured Housing however. The same can be said for placing a Tiny Home on a parcel. Some Counties allow for it, some do not. You're on the right track, find the land, (acreage/land price will vary depending on where the land is) and, perhaps you will locate an Older MH that needs renovated that you can have transported to your parcel. There's a cost to moving/transporting that home, but, it may be less than buying a new model. And, as we've seen on this channel, there are many MH's that need rehabbing.
